Transaction 33b8e76f529effefd753270cee1e95574b7baa45f10526b4060692f01709341c

1 Input
2 Outputs
  • 33b8e76f529effefd753270cee1e95574b7baa45f10526b4060692f01709341c:0
  • value  570798649
    address  1CzhG3wo49wYz8UepUEuCmJhTHTvh93JTy
  • 33b8e76f529effefd753270cee1e95574b7baa45f10526b4060692f01709341c:1
  • value  3558928
    address  14WfxEX1dd1mjyNWcbHqE2rrnYiTnRbMyS